The AOCA just completed its most successful Annual Convention. Held in Las Vegas at the Cosmopolitan Hotel, attendees were offered 26 hours of Category 1 CME, from the convention program chair, Celia Maneri, D.O., F.A.O.C.A.
New Officers include President Toni R. Patterson, D.O., F.A.O.C.A., President-elect Raymond Sohn, D.O., F.A.O.C.A., Vice President Paul Gray, II, D.O., F.A.O.C.A., and Treasurer, Thomas P. Costello, D.O., F.A.O.C.A. New members of the Board of Governors elected at the annual business meeting were Jeffrey Kyff, D.O., F.A.O.C.A., and Robert G. Vandergraaf, D.O., F.A.O.C.A.
Newly recognized fellows installed during the ceremonial banquet include, Carlo, J. Cutler, D.O., Thomas M. Gemma, D.O., Martin Laskey, D.O., and David G. Ninan, D.O.
Dennis E. Kane, D.O., F.A.O.C.A. received the Distinguished Service Award, James A. Skrabak, D.O., F.A.O.C.A. was recognized for presenting the annual Crawford Myles Esterline Lecture, and David Jabs, D.O. received the outstanding Scientific Essay Award.
Dr. Norman E. Vinn, D.O., President-elect of the American Osteopathic Association brought greetings and made remarks at the banquet.
